What the Polk County Surveyor's Office can do:
- Recovers, restores and protects original section donation land claim corner and section locations. For more information, please visit the Government Corner Restoration Program page.
- Reviews pending subdivisions and partition plat maps for compliance with Oregon statutes and County requirements, mathematical accuracy, visual clarity, easements, encroachments and other potential issues, then adds them to the survey records.
- Receives private survey maps for filing, reviews them for compliance with Oregon statutes and County requirements, and adds them to the public and survey records.
- Assists the general public with locating records and historical research in property surveys, subdivision plats, partition plats, condominium plats, cemetery plats, road records, public easements, local access roads, gateways, County surveys, control surveys, GPS surveys and general survey questions. It is important to remember that not all property has been surveyed and may only be a division on paper, recorded in the deed records. In addition, some survey monuments marking land boundaries have no survey recorded, due to the fact that the survey pre-dates recording requirements and the monument reference may only show up in deeds, if at all.
